One Year Stats!

Monday, April 14th, 2008

We went to Desmond’s 1 year check up today. He is doing great, we finished filling out the developmental milestone sheet, only problem with that is we don’t get a new one till he is 2, since that sheet is for 9 months to 24 months. Oh well at least we know he is developing well.

He had one shot, his DTaP and didn’t seem to mind it. We’ll get him another shot at his 15 month appointment. Based on our plans for his delayed shot schedule he should be caught up to all the vaccines we plan to get him by the time he’s 3. I bet that will make his pediatrician happy at least (you can see her squirm about us delaying).

His growth has slowed some, but that is expected he grew an inch since his 9 month appointment and gained a pound and 5 ounces. He is in the 50thpercentile for weight now and the 75th percentile for height. He is in the 80th percentile for head circumference (48cm).

Now for the stats from birth to 1:

At birth he was 7 pounds 14 ounces and 20 3/4 inches
At one months he was 11 pounds and 23 inches
At two months he was 14 pounds and 24 1/2 inches
At four months he was 17 pounds 13 ounces and 26 1/2 inches
At 6 months he was 19 pounds 13 ounces and 27 inches
At 9 months he was 22 pounds 3 ounces and 29 inches
At 1 year (12 months) he is 23 pounds 8 ounces and 30 inches

So he’s gained 15 pounds and 14 ounces in a year, almost exactly tripling his birth weight (he is 2 ounces over tripling). He’s also grown 9 and 1/4th inches. So he had a great first year and gained weight and height quite nicely. We are extremely pleased. Now to see how much he grows in his second year of life.
